What is a Specialist Glazier?

A specialist glazier is a tradesperson with specific expertise in the installation and repair of glass components. Unlike basic glaziers, specialist glaziers concentrate on distinct glass items and advanced applications, which might include stained glass, custom glass architecture, energy-efficient glazing, and safety glazing. Their high-level abilities enable them to efficiently manage more complex tasks and even provide consultancy services in custom glass design.

Key Responsibilities

The tasks of a specialist glazier might differ depending upon the particular niche they run within. Nevertheless, their primary duties usually consist of:

  • Assessing task requirements and glass specifications.
  • Measuring and cutting glass to exact measurements.
  • Setting up and securing glass in various structures.
  • Fixing broken or damaged glass installations.
  • Encouraging customers on suitable glass products for their projects.
  • Ensuring compliance with security policies and building regulations.
  • Using maintenance and care ideas for glass installations.

Types of Specialist Glazing

Specialist glaziers work across different sectors, each needing various methods and products. Here is a breakdown:

  • Commercial Glazing: Focused on workplace structures and storefronts utilizing large glass panels.
  • Residential Glazing: Involves single-family homes, requiring setups like doors and windows.
  • Architectural Glazing: Combining artistry and engineering to develop aesthetically sensational glass structures.
  • Security Glazing: Installing toughened or laminated glass in locations where security is critical, such as schools or health centers.
  • Stained Glass: Creating creative glass pieces for churches or homes.

The Importance of Specialist Glaziers in Modern Construction

In modern-day architecture, where glass is frequently a main façade product, specialist glaziers are essential. They not only add to the aesthetic appeal of structures but likewise boost energy performance through contemporary glazing technologies. Their contributions include:

  • Energy Efficiency: Using double or triple glazing to provide insulation and sound decrease.
  • Visual Appeal: Crafting custom glass services that boost the general design integrity of a structure.
  • Building Regulations Compliance: Ensuring that installations meet security and sustainability standards.

Frequently asked questions

What certifications do specialist glaziers need?Specialist glaziers generally need a high school diploma and an apprenticeship. Numerous also pursue certifications in specific glazing methods.

Can specialist glaziers work on any type of structure?While they often concentrate on particular sectors, such as residential or commercial, skilled glaziers can deal with diverse kinds of structures as required.

The length of time does it normally take to finish a glazing job?The timeframe can vary commonly depending on the task size, complexity, and specific requirements-- varying from a few days for small installations to numerous weeks for big constructions.

What type of tools do specialist glaziers utilize?Tools consist of glass cutters, safety devices, measuring gadgets, suction cups for handling, and various adhesives and sealants.

Exist various materials used in glazing?Yes, specialist glaziers work with numerous products, including tempered glass, laminated glass, and low-emissivity (low-e) glass for improved energy performance.
